Surely, you have heard of the expression If its not broken, dont fix it! What does that really mean to you? I smell a skunk. The smell of a skunk is a warning that something is not right. Clean out your ears, and open your eyes widely so that you are aware of unforeseen happenings around you when it comes to your children and young adults. You cant put a price on safety. Their lives are worth more than that. It burns my heart when I hear that children and young adults have been taken or, should I say, have gone missing. I hurt along with that parent because her childyour childcould have been my child. My blood runs cold wondering where that child is. What hurts the most is not knowing whether or not that child is alive. No parent should have to go through something like that. So you ask me why I wrote this book? Ask yourself why such a book should not be written. First of all, look beyond the high risen. You should get on your knees and thank God for this book. The person behind this book is thinking of youthe parent. Finally, this book is to make parents aware that unless they get involved, its not going to stop.
